|
dune-pdelab 2.10-git
|
Loading...
Searching...
No Matches
powergridfunctionspace.hh
Go to the documentation of this file.
113 PowerGridFunctionSpace(const std::array<std::shared_ptr<T>,k>& container, const Backend& backend = Backend(), const OrderingTag ordering_tag = OrderingTag())
118 PowerGridFunctionSpace(T& c, const Backend& backend = Backend(), const OrderingTag ordering_tag = OrderingTag())
#define DUNE_THROW(E,...)
Traits::Backend & backend()
Definition gridfunctionspacebase.hh:281
void update(bool force=false)
Update the indexing information of the GridFunctionSpace.
Definition gridfunctionspacebase.hh:259
O OrderingTag
Definition powercompositegridfunctionspacebase.hh:100
bool isRootSpace() const
Definition gridfunctionspacebase.hh:346
G EntitySet
Definition powercompositegridfunctionspacebase.hh:45
For backward compatibility – Do not use this!
type Type
static transformed_type transform(const SourceTree &s, const Transformation &t=Transformation())
Definition exceptions.hh:36
a class holding transformation for constrained spaces
Definition constraintstransformation.hh:20
Definition constraintstransformation.hh:112
Definition datahandleprovider.hh:189
Definition gridfunctionspacebase.hh:190
Trait class for the multi component grid function spaces.
Definition powercompositegridfunctionspacebase.hh:35
Mixin class providing common functionality of PowerGridFunctionSpace and CompositeGridFunctionSpace.
Definition powercompositegridfunctionspacebase.hh:73
base class for tuples of grid function spaces product of identical grid function spaces base class th...
Definition powergridfunctionspace.hh:49
PowerGridFunctionSpace(T &c0, T &c1, T &c2, T &c3, T &c4, T &c5, T &c6, T &c7, T &c8, const Backend &backend=Backend(), const OrderingTag ordering_tag=OrderingTag())
Definition powergridfunctionspace.hh:200
Ordering & ordering()
Direct access to the DOF ordering.
Definition powergridfunctionspace.hh:254
ordering_transformation::Type Ordering
Definition powergridfunctionspace.hh:83
PowerGridFunctionSpaceTag ImplementationTag
Definition powergridfunctionspace.hh:53
PowerGridFunctionSpace(const std::array< std::shared_ptr< T >, k > &container, const Backend &backend=Backend(), const OrderingTag ordering_tag=OrderingTag())
Construct a new Power Grid Function Space object.
Definition powergridfunctionspace.hh:113
PowerGridFunctionSpace(T &c0, T &c1, T &c2, T &c3, T &c4, T &c5, T &c6, const Backend &backend=Backend(), const OrderingTag ordering_tag=OrderingTag())
Definition powergridfunctionspace.hh:173
PowerGridFunctionSpace(std::shared_ptr< Child0 > child0, std::shared_ptr< Children >... children)
Definition powergridfunctionspace.hh:232
PowerGridFunctionSpace(T &c0, T &c1, T &c2, T &c3, const Backend &backend=Backend(), const OrderingTag ordering_tag=OrderingTag())
Definition powergridfunctionspace.hh:140
PowerGridFunctionSpace(T &c0, T &c1, const Backend &backend=Backend(), const OrderingTag ordering_tag=OrderingTag())
Definition powergridfunctionspace.hh:123
PowerGridFunctionSpace(T &c, const Backend &backend=Backend(), const OrderingTag ordering_tag=OrderingTag())
Definition powergridfunctionspace.hh:118
std::shared_ptr< const Ordering > orderingStorage() const
Direct access to the storage of the DOF ordering.
Definition powergridfunctionspace.hh:270
PowerGridFunctionSpace(T &c0, T &c1, T &c2, T &c3, T &c4, T &c5, T &c6, T &c7, T &c8, T &c9, const Backend &backend=Backend(), const OrderingTag ordering_tag=OrderingTag())
Definition powergridfunctionspace.hh:215
PowerGridFunctionSpace(T &c0, T &c1, T &c2, const Backend &backend=Backend(), const OrderingTag ordering_tag=OrderingTag())
Definition powergridfunctionspace.hh:131
PowerGridFunctionSpace(T &c0, T &c1, T &c2, T &c3, T &c4, T &c5, T &c6, T &c7, const Backend &backend=Backend(), const OrderingTag ordering_tag=OrderingTag())
Definition powergridfunctionspace.hh:186
TypeTree::PowerNode< T, k > BaseT
Definition powergridfunctionspace.hh:55
PowerGridFunctionSpace(T &c0, T &c1, T &c2, T &c3, T &c4, T &c5, const Backend &backend=Backend(), const OrderingTag ordering_tag=OrderingTag())
Definition powergridfunctionspace.hh:161
ImplementationBase::Traits Traits
export traits class
Definition powergridfunctionspace.hh:104
PowerGridFunctionSpace(T &c0, T &c1, T &c2, T &c3, T &c4, const Backend &backend=Backend(), const OrderingTag ordering_tag=OrderingTag())
Definition powergridfunctionspace.hh:150
const Ordering & ordering() const
Direct access to the DOF ordering.
Definition powergridfunctionspace.hh:238
std::shared_ptr< Ordering > orderingStorage()
Direct access to the storage of the DOF ordering.
Definition powergridfunctionspace.hh:286
extract type for storing constraints
Definition powergridfunctionspace.hh:88
std::conditional< std::is_same< typenameT::templateConstraintsContainer< E >::Type, EmptyTransformation >::value, EmptyTransformation, ConstraintsTransformation< typenameOrdering::Traits::DOFIndex, typenameOrdering::Traits::ContainerIndex, E > >::type Type
Definition powergridfunctionspace.hh:100
Definition gridfunctionspace/tags.hh:26
Legal Statements / Impressum | Hosted by TU Dresden & Uni Heidelberg | Generated by
1.9.8